A rigid coupling is a unit of hardware used to join two shafts within a motor or mechanical system. It may be used to connect two separate systems, such as a motor and a generator, or to repair a connection within a single system. A rigid coupling may also be added between shafts to reduce shock and wear at the point where the shafts meet.
Features of TS7C rigid coupling:
1.Light weight,extremely low inertia and high response
2.Available in aluminum alloy and stainless steel
3.Clamp type
